Definitions and Meaning of ruffled in English

ruffled adjective

  1. having decorative ruffles or frillsadj.all
  2. shaken into waves or undulations as by windadj.all

    Examples

    • "the rippled surface of the pond"
    • "with ruffled flags flying"
